WebNov 15, 2015 · To prevent cellulitis in the future. Try to prevent cuts, scrapes, or other injuries to your skin. Cellulitis most often occurs where there is a break in the skin. If you get a scrape, cut, mild burn, or bite, wash the wound with clean water as soon as you can to help avoid infection. Don't use hydrogen peroxide or alcohol, which can slow healing.
